Setting the Film Type Scanning Select the appropriate film type for the film being scanned. It is important to set this setting correctly to reproduce colors faithfully. Film Type Selection Click the arrow button to display the list of film types in a pull-down menu. Position the mouse cursor over the item you wish to select and click. Your selection will appear in the box when the pull-down menu closes. Select one of these for a 35 mm film. Select one of these for 4" x 5" or 120 format film. Select one of these for an OHP transparency or large format film. • • NOTE • There are two formats for 35 mm film: sleeves or mounts. Select the correct option for each format.
